What is a zip line operator?

Zip line operators are professionals responsible for setting up, maintaining, and supervising zip line activities at adventure parks, resorts, or outdoor recreation sites. Their main duties include ensuring safety protocols are followed, instructing participants on proper equipment use, and assisting with harnessing and launching riders. They also inspect the zip line equipment regularly and provide emergency support if necessary. Excellent communication, safety awareness, and customer service skills are essential for this role.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a zip line guide?

To thrive as a Zip Line Guide, you need knowledge of safety procedures, basic first aid certification, and physical fitness, often supported by on-the-job training or outdoor recreation experience. Familiarity with harnesses, belay systems, radios, and inspection protocols is essential. Strong communication, customer service skills, and the ability to remain calm under pressure help guides create a positive and safe experience for guests. These skills and qualities ensure participant safety, efficient operations, and memorable adventures in an outdoor setting.

What are some common safety challenges faced by zip line guides, and how are these addressed in daily operations?

Zip Line Guides frequently encounter safety challenges such as ensuring all equipment is properly maintained, monitoring weather conditions, and guiding participants with varying levels of experience. To address these, guides conduct thorough pre-shift inspections of harnesses, cables, and platforms, provide detailed safety briefings to guests, and follow strict operational protocols. Ongoing training and teamwork are essential, as guides must coordinate closely to respond effectively to emergencies and maintain a safe, enjoyable environment for all participants.

Zip Line and Ropes Course Instructor roles both involve outdoor adventure activities, requiring safety certifications and working in outdoor recreational environments. While zip line operators focus on managing and operating zip line equipment, ropes course instructors oversee obstacle courses and team-building activities. Both roles are essential in adventure parks and outdoor recreation settings, often overlapping in skills and certifications.
